Wind Advisory
-URGENT - WEATHER MESSAGE National Weather Service Aberdeen SD 212 AM CST Sun Jan 18 2026 Campbell-McPherson-Walworth-Edmunds-Potter-Faulk-Sully-Hughes- Hyde-Hand-Lyman-Buffalo- Including the cities of Mobridge, Ipswich, Onida, Gettysburg, Eureka, Faulkton, Fort Thompson, Miller, Kennebec, Highmore, Herreid, and Pierre 212 AM CST Sun Jan 18 2026 ...WIND ADVISORY REMAINS IN EFFECT FROM 6 AM THIS MORNING TO 6 PM CST THIS EVENING... * WHAT...Northwest winds 30 to 40 mph with gusts up to 55 mph expected. * WHERE...Portions of central and north central South Dakota. * WHEN...From 6 AM this morning to 6 PM CST this evening. * IMPACTS...Gusty winds will blow around unsecured objects and a few power outages may result.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S...Light snow Sunday, combined with the strong winds, will result in significantly reduced visibility at times with short periods of white out conditions.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... Winds this strong can make driving difficult, especially for high profile vehicles. Use extra caution. &&
Winter Weather Advisory
-URGENT - WINTER WEATHER MESSAGE National Weather Service Aberdeen SD 212 AM CST Sun Jan 18 2026 Campbell-McPherson-Brown-Walworth-Edmunds-Potter-Faulk-Spink- Clark-Codington-Hamlin-Deuel-Sully-Hughes-Hyde-Hand-Lyman-Buffalo- Including the cities of Mobridge, Ipswich, Onida, Kennebec, Hayti, Gettysburg, Eureka, Clear Lake, Clark, Redfield, Faulkton, Watertown, Fort Thompson, Miller, Aberdeen, Highmore, Herreid, and Pierre 212 AM CST Sun Jan 18 2026 ...WINTER WEATHER ADVISORY REMAINS IN EFFECT UNTIL 9 PM CST THIS EVENING... * WHAT...Snow showers and areas of blowing snow expected. Visibilities less than half mile expected in intermittent snow showers. Total snow accumulations up to one inch. Winds gusting as high as 55 mph. * WHERE...Portions of central, north central, and northeast South Dakota. * WHEN...Until 9 PM CST this evening. * IMPACTS...Plan on slippery road conditions. Widespread blowing snow, frequently reducing visibility below a half mile, will make travel dangerous, especially in open country. Strong winds could cause tree damage.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... Slow down and use caution while traveling. The latest road conditions can be obtained by calling 5 1 1. &&
